The Infamous Egg Drop at Baxter Elementary

Excitement filled the air as 4th graders at T.E.Baxter Elementary watched their team's egg drop from various heights.   In a carefully designed cushioned case, students had to predict if their egg would survive a fall from the highest point – a 30 ft. bucket lift.

Lane (pictured left) who is in Mrs. Rodgers's class said, "This is so fun.  My team did a good job because our egg didn't break."

There were 16 out of 29 teams whose egg did not crack. This project is part of the 4th grade introduction to science curriculum.  Designing fun lessons is one way to engage students' interest in the learning process.
